This property is a real gem. Shows lots of loving care. Beautiful amenities in kitchen, dining room, primary bedroom and two baths on main level. Two nice sized bedrooms on the second floor. Glassed in porch overlooking the park like back yard. Perfect spot to watch the famous Claremont Fourth of July fireworks. Immaculate oversized two car drive through garage with lots of strorage above or could be an awesome playroom or additional living area.

PLEASE NOTE: Both New Hampshire and Vermont law require brokers and agents to disclose at the “time of first business meeting, prior to any discussion of confidential information”, in New Hampshire’s case, and “first reasonable opportunity”, in Vermont’s case, the nature of the relationships brokers have or may have with customers and clients. Each state requires that a disclosure form be presented to consumers for their review and acknowledgment at the appropriate time. These forms can be accessed here:
